Summary
Avril is a Belgian film directed by Gérald Hustache-Mathieu in 2006. Set within the confines of an isolated convent following the strict Baptistine order, the story focuses on Avril, a young woman raised by nuns since birth and preparing to take her final vows. The film explores themes of identity, freedom, and the constraints of religious life through Avril's journey of discovery after learning about her twin brother.
